Casey Oliver was born on March 12, 2001, in Indianapolis, Indiana. Standing at 6'7" and weighing 215 pounds, Oliver showcased his basketball prowess early on, dominating high school competitions. His journey to college basketball was marked by a standout performance at Lawrence North High School, where he averaged 22.5 points and 8.3 rebounds per game in his senior year. This performance earned him a scholarship to play in the NCAA, setting the stage for his collegiate career.
Oliver is known for his versatile playing style, combining agility and strength to excel both offensively and defensively. With a keen eye for the basket, he's particularly effective in mid-range shooting and has a knack for creating scoring opportunities. Defensively, Oliver's height and wingspan make him a formidable opponent, often leading to key blocks and rebounds. His ability to adapt to various positions on the court makes him a valuable asset to his team.
During his time in the NCAAB, Oliver has consistently been a top performer. In the 2022-2023 season, he averaged 18.7 points and 7.2 rebounds per game, earning him a spot on the All-Conference First Team. His performance in the NCAA Tournament, where he led his team to the Sweet 16, further solidified his reputation as a clutch player. Oliver's contributions have not only been pivotal in his team's success but have also caught the attention of NBA scouts.
